site stats

Parallel programming online compiler

WebJan 30, 2024 · Code explicitly written to take advantage of parallel computing, however, usually loses the benefit of compilers’ optimization strategies. That’s because managing … WebHowever, parallel programming is challenging because of the skills, experiences, and knowledge needed to avoid common parallel programming traps and pitfalls. This paper proposes the ForeC synchronous multi-threaded programming language for the deterministic, parallel, and reactive programming of embedded multi-cores.

Parallel Programming in .NET: A guide to the documentation

WebCode, Compile & Run. Compile & run your code with the CodeChef online IDE. Our online compiler supports multiple programming languages like Python, C++, C, Kotlin, … WebThe articles in this volume are revised versions of the best papers presented at the Fifth Workshop on Languages and Compilers for Parallel Computing, held at Yale University, August 1992. The previous workshops in this series were held in Santa Clara (1991), Irvine (1990), Urbana (1989), and Ithaca (1988). how to credit card a door https://creativebroadcastprogramming.com

What Is Parallel Programming? TotalView by Perforce

WebLearn to code in Python, C/C++, Java, and other popular programming languages with our easy to follow tutorials, examples, online compiler and references. WebWrite, Run & Share Erlang code online using OneCompiler's Erlang online compiler for free. It's one of the robust, feature-rich online compilers for Erlang language, running on … WebAditya Avinash is a graduate student who focuses on computer graphics and GPUs. His areas of interest are compilers, drivers, physically based rendering, and real-time rendering. His current focus is on making a contribution to MESA (the open source graphics driver stack for Linux), where he will implement OpenGL extensions for the AMD backend. how to credit card

7 Collaborative Coding Tools for Remote Pair Programming

Category:Compiler-aided nd-range parallel-for implementations on CPU in …

Tags:Parallel programming online compiler

Parallel programming online compiler

Hello OpenMP - OpenMP - CodinGame

Webprovides a general overview of parallel programming, summarizing the challenges inherent in writing parallel programs, the techniques that can be used to create them, and the metrics ... neither of which form a useful foundation for a compiler concerned with portable performance. For more details on the CTA, please refer to the literature ... WebC++ is a compiled, high-performance language. Robots, automobiles, and embedded software all depend on C++ for speed of execution. This program is designed to turn software engineers into C++ developers. You will use C++ to develop object-oriented programs, to manage memory and system resources, and to implement parallel …

Parallel programming online compiler

Did you know?

WebApr 7, 2024 · I used to run all the codes in my institute's HPC cluster, but due to some mishap they are down for the past few days and I don't know when they will be back. Is … WebOnline C Compiler. Code, Compile, Run and Debug C program online. Write your code in this editor and press "Run" button to compile and execute it. …

WebNov 30, 2024 · In C++ Builder, the RTL provides the Parallel Programming Library (PPL), giving your applications the ability to have tasks running in parallel taking advantage of … WebBecause it simplifies parallel programming through elegant support for: distributed arrays that can leverage thousands of nodes' memories and cores a global namespace supporting direct access to local or remote variables data parallelism to trivially use the cores of a laptop, cluster, or supercomputer

WebApr 7, 2024 · Functional and parallel programming: DataLang will encourage functional programming practices and support parallel processing for better performance on large-scale data tasks. ... Run the compiler: Finally, run the datalang_compiler.py script with a DataLang source file as input, and observe the output or the generated code. ... WebParallel computing is a type of computation in which many calculations or processes are carried out simultaneously. Large problems can often be divided into smaller ones, which …

WebOnline, instructor-led. Time to Complete. 10 weeks, 15-25 hrs/week. Tuition. $4,200.00 - $5,600.00. Academic credits. 3 - 4 units. Most new computer architectures are parallel, requiring programmers to know the basic issues and techniques for writing this software. This course is an introduction to the basic issues of and techniques for writing ...

WebCSE 110A Compiler Design I CSE 110B Compiler Design II CSE 111 Advanced Programming CSE 112 Comparative Programming Languages CSE 113 Parallel Programming CSE 118 Mobile Applications CSE 132 Computer Security CSE 138 Distributed Systems: File Sharing, Online Gaming, and More CSE 139 Data Storage … how to credit card fraudWebA pipelined multi-threading parallelizing compiler could assign each of these six operations to a different processor, perhaps arranged in a systolic array, inserting the appropriate code to forward the output of one processor to the next processor. how to credit card accountWebWrite and run HTML, CSS and JavaScript code using our online editor. Our HTML editor updates the webview automatically in real-time as you write code. Give it a try. how to credit card numberWebOCaml An industrial-strength functional programming language with an emphasis on expressiveness and safety that combines the reliability of the camel with the agility of the antelope Get started About OCaml Latest release: 5.0.0 (Camelope edition) how to credit card loanWebAug 4, 2024 · NVC++ supports C++17, C++ Standard Parallelism (stdpar) for CPU and GPU, OpenACC for CPU and GPU, and OpenMP for CPU. NVC++ can compile Standard C++ algorithms with the parallel execution policies std::execution::par or std::execution::par_unseq for execution on NVIDIA GPUs. how to credit card consolidationWebBy adopting two compiler-based approaches solving this, the present work improves the performance of the nd-range parallel-for in hipSYCL for CPUs by up to multiple orders of magnitude on various CPU architectures. The two alternatives are compared with regard to their functional correctness and performance. the metropolitan achievement testWebNov 2, 2011 · Adding parallel compiler directives manually. Adding the -Qparallel (Windows*) or -parallel (Linux* or macOS*) option to the compile command is the only … how to credit card limit increase